Legal Issues Seminar-General IP (LIS-GIP) On “Is ‘Degree of Control’ by the Proprietor a pre-requisite for a Valid Trademark License?”

Featuring: Anurathna Mathivanan

A ‘Legal Issues Seminar- General IP’ (LIS-GIP) was conducted by Anurathna Mathivanan, Associate, on “Is ‘Degree of Control’ by the Proprietor a pre-requisite for a Valid Trademark License?”. The seminar analysed licensed use of registered trademark and the requirements of a valid trademark license as prescribed under the Trade Marks Act, 1999. The session delved into various judicial decisions that have considered the applicability of the requirements under the Trade Marks Act, 1999 to licenses that are entered into under common law.  The seminar traced the various requirements of valid trademark licenses, as laid out by Courts, and the requirement to ensure a connection in the course of trade between the Licensor and the Licensee. The session concluded with an interesting discussion on the standard of quality control to be employed by the Licensor, and the control over licensee’s use of the trademark to ensure distinctiveness of the trademark.
